Ice hockey perspective team clearly loses in Slovakia


Without its best players, the German national ice hockey team has no chance in Slovakia. Before the game, the thoughts are with a died international.

The German national ice hockey team lost the first of two test games against Slovakia. In Banská Bystrica in Slovak, the so -called perspective team lost 0: 4 (0: 1, 0: 2, 0: 1). National coach Harold Kreis waived all top performers and used the games to test numerous players. Already on Thursday (6:00 p.m./Magentasport) the second meeting is also due in Banská Bystrica.

In memory of the international Tobias Eder, who died last week, a minute’s silence took place before the match. In addition, the selection of the German Ice Hockey Association played with a mourning flor. Eder died last Wednesday at the age of 26 after cancer.

The district team with eleven debutants was on the ice after 55 seconds. Sebastian Cederle was successful for the hosts early and increased a few minutes after the beginning of the second round (25th minute). In his first international match, the 24-year-old was also responsible for the 0: 3 (32nd).

Germany’s goalkeeper Arno Tiefensee from the Adler Mannheim saved his team from an even higher gap. During the fourth goal by Daniel TKAC, Tiefensee did not look good (55th).

The two games against Slovakia are the only test games for the German national ice hockey team before starting the World Cup preparation in April. The World Cup in Denmark and Sweden begins on May 9th. The DEB selection plays in the preliminary round against Hungary, Kazakhstan, Norway, Switzerland, USA, world champion Czech Republic and host Denmark.
